The East Rock Support Staff are a team of professionals that are dedicated to developing the academic, social and emotional potential of all students as they become a part of a global society. The Support Staff includes a School Counselor, School Social Worker, School Psychologist, Speech Therapist and a PPT Chairperson. Together we plan and provide educational programs for students with disabilities in partnership with regular education staff, administration and parents.
We believe that each child has the ability to learn when given the opportunity in an evolving educational environment. It is our responsibility, along with the regular education staff, to foster within each child the belief in that value through discovering their talents, developing their skills, and encouraging self-confidence and independence. We believe that families are a valuable part of the educational process and a vital part of the education process. Their input and insights about their children help us to understand and plan for the future of their child’s education.
